Hi team — ahead of the weekly sync, a note for our new on-call engineer on per-tenant rate quotas in Thornbeam. Quotas are enforced at the gateway per tenant tier; bursts up to 2x are tolerated for 60 seconds before throttling kicks in. If a tenant pages about 429s, check their tier and recent burst history before granting a temporary raise. The quota dashboard and escalation steps are documented here.

runbook for badug-kadup: https://confluence.zemvarlabs.internal/projects/browse/display/projects/bd1b

# Env for Fernlock greenhouse controller — bay 2.
# Context for eng sync: sensor drift last sprint came from stale calibration constants cached locally.
# Controller now pulls fresh offsets from the Wexvale calibration service every 15 min.
# Do not hardcode offsets here again. Do not point at staging.
# Wexvale rejects unauthenticated pulls; its access secret goes on the next line:

sealed setting: ARCHIVE_KEY3=8d0

Reminder job for Brightwell Clinic appointments is flaking in CI. The test seeds appointments in local clinic time, but the job under test converts to UTC before filtering, so anything near midnight falls outside the window. Fails only on runners pinned to the Ostermere region image. Fix in review normalizes both sides to UTC at the query boundary. Please verify the timezone table fixture too. Repro is deterministic against the build referenced by the token below.

build token for bahip-fawif: htk3_6a1

Subject: Revised Commission Scheme — Effective Next Quarter

Team,

The new plan replaces flat-rate payouts with tiered accelerators above 110% of quota. Multi-year Brellix contracts earn a 1.5x kicker. Clawbacks apply to cancellations within 90 days. Draft calculators go to sales leads Monday; feedback due Thursday. No exceptions this cycle.

Mira will walk the exec team through modelling at Friday's sync. Context on the underlying strategy is noted below.

internal memo for yahaf-hawif: The finance team signed off on a budget of $59.9 million for Project Rusax.